In Map Viewer classic there is an option to set default style for layers. For example if I overwrite the service with new styles I can set default style in Map Viewer Classic. Can't see this option in new map viewer.

Good morning, found this post and I would like to add some more detail.

Let me add that using the default styles from the layer it's not only a fact of  usability in configuration.
It also has a performance downgrade: When the styles are setup at web map level, then the applications has to send the styles (json) on every query it's done to the servers. Those styles have to be parsed, etc... On the other hand when using the default styles from the layer, this is not necessary.

On mapserver the performance also means that starts making 2 queryies (POST to /export) instead of a direct GET query.

I'd like this functionality ported as well.  It's not something that I should need to do often, @RussRoberts, but it does come up.  The workarounds for not being able to simply remove configured drawing info from a layer are not good.

  1. Create Web Styles, which makes sense for symbols that would be re-used but is a lot of superfluous work and data for one-off symbologies AND a waste of compute in order to apply the published symbology to a layer.
  2. Re-add and re-configure layers, duplicating work.
  3. Use some admin tools or scripting to update the item's json directly... ew.

As the 3.x JS API disappears into the past and Map Viewer Classic goes with it, it will become a substantially greater annoyance to deal with this issue.  Please consider exposing the ability to remove web map layer renderer configurations in the new Map Viewer.

No immediate plans to add this to styling panel yet but we do have a reset to source control on the layer that will reset the layer back to its original state. This would in the case for a layer added by URL set the layer back to the source URL props while if it was from an item the layer would reset to the item configuration.
